Subject Description | A continuation of work begun in Screen Studies 1. The subject gives students some familiarity with film-makers who have challenged the assumptions of conventional narrative, producing interesting new approaches: introduces students to the underlying determining influences of a range of subtexts including those based on myth, gender, psychoanalysis and ideologies. |
Assessment | Essay up to 1,500 words and/or seminar presentation of not more than 30 minutes (80%); Class attendance (20%). |
